
Genetics and Overview
Cinnamon Buddha OG seeds by Humboldt Seed Organization represent a refined cannabis strain developed through the expert crossing of the legendary ‘Florida cut’ OG, also known as ‘The Triangle,’ and Humboldt Seed Organization’s own Fire OG. This hybrid strain pays homage to classic OG genetics, boasting a distinctive structure with thinner fan leaves and large, fist-sized buds that are heavily coated in resin. Cinnamon Buddha OG seeds have been carefully bred to offer a well-balanced and resilient cultivar, making them suitable for both novice growers and experienced cultivators seeking reliable performance and exceptional quality.
Flavor Profile
The flavor of Cinnamon Buddha OG is a signature aspect that defines this strain’s unique appeal. True to its name, it delivers pronounced spicy cinnamon notes that create a warm, inviting taste profile. These spicy terpenes are beautifully complemented by hints of pine and nutmeg, enhanced further by subtle lemon pepper nuances that add a zesty brightness. Underlying these flavors are earthy citric undertones, which round out the complex palate, making Cinnamon Buddha OG seeds a favorite for those who appreciate a rich, multi-dimensional flavor experience with every inhale.

Cultivation Characteristics
Cinnamon Buddha OG thrives best in dry, arid climates and mountain desert environments, where its robust genetics can fully express themselves. When grown outdoors, this strain can reach impressive heights of up to 15 feet (4.5 meters), making it ideal for growers with ample space who desire large, productive plants. Indoor cultivation typically yields between 400 and 450 grams per square meter, while outdoor plants can produce remarkable harvests ranging from 6 to 8 pounds or more per plant, depending on care and conditions.
With a flowering period of approximately 63 days, Cinnamon Buddha OG seeds demonstrate vigorous growth and resilience. The plant’s ability to develop visually stunning, resin-rich buds ensures it remains a prized choice among growers.
